Balmore Golf Club's Chris Maclean has two wins from three rounds on Get Back To Golf tour

Balmore Golf Club professional Chris Maclean made it two wins out of three when he came out on top in the latest round of the Get Back to Golf Tour at Arbroath Links.

Maclean won the opening round of the competition at Castle Stuart last month to book his place in the tour's grand final at Dumbarnie Links St Andrews, in October.

Now he has added the third round for good measure, carding a seven-under-par 63 to win by two shots from professionals John Henry (Clydebank) and Scott Grant (Panmure).

With Maclean having already booked his place in the 12-strong field for the final, Henry took the available place thanks to a better inward half.

Maclean was understandably delighted with another win.

He said: “Chuffed to bits and delighted to shoot seven under round a tricky golf course.

“Played really nicely, hit some great wedge approach shots and had my putting boots on all day.”
